Default Fuji crystal archive.

I assume you're asking about colour paper. I always use Fuji crystal archive. It is thicker than Kodak's royal paper and has a much better matte surface (matte paper). Fuji crystal archive is also rated the one with the longest print life : 60 years under test conditions, compared to 30 for Kodak.

As for black and white, I use to print mainly on Agfa classic fibre based glossy paper or agfa premium RC semi matte.
